“Rare Inflammatory Myofibroblastic Tumor in Upper Arm with Brachial Artery Involvement: Radiological and Pathological Implications”

This abstract reports a rare case of an Inflammatory Myofibroblastic Tumor (IMT) in the upper arm with brachial artery involvement, highlighting the importance of radiological characteristics and pathology in diagnosis, and expanding the understanding of its imaging features and differential diagnosis of limb neoplasm.
